titleOfInvention Process of forming phospate coatings on metal surfaces
abstract A process of forming phosphate coatings on metal surfaces by a treatment with aqueous iron(II) and nitrate ions-containing zinc phosphate solutions can be carried out without a formation of waste water if metal surfaces are contacted with a phosphating solution which contains: 0.4 to 30 g/l Zn, 4 to 30 g/l P205, 5 to 50 g/l N03, from greater than 0 to 10 g/l Fe(II), and from greater than 0 to 0.3 g/l Fe(III) and in which the weight ratio of free P205 to total P2O5 = (0.04 to 0.50) : 1 and which is replenished with Zn, NO3 and P2O5 in a weight ratio of: Zn : NO3 : P205 = (0.80 to 0.30) : (0.17 to 0.4) : 1 and in which the Fe(II) content is adjusted only by an oxidation with nitrate or nitrite derived from nitrate, nitrite derived from nitrate, employed optionally together with an oxygen-containing gas, H202 and/or nitrous gases, the phosphating bath is succeeded by a cascade of at least two rinsing baths, low-salt water or salt-free water is fed to that rinsing bath which is the last in the direction of travel of the workpieces, the overflowing water is fed to the next preceding rinsing bath and to the phosphating bath, respectively, and low-salt or salt-free water is withdrawn from the phosphating bath at least at such a rate that the phosphate-enriched rinsing water form the cascade can be fed to the phosphating bath.
